Question 885715: This is a statistic problem so I hope I can get a little guidance.
The data value x=34 has a deviation (from the mean) value of 16. Explain the meaning of this and what the mean would be equal to.

You can put this solution on YOUR website! The average deviation measures how far each observation lies from the mean, on average. Therefore,
34 - 16 = mean = 18
